Transaction 515886c7f6125fcfa81d6df5451ad7fe6e8f025de9c3639cc2d4b9d0437ec52d

1 Input
2 Outputs
  • 515886c7f6125fcfa81d6df5451ad7fe6e8f025de9c3639cc2d4b9d0437ec52d:0
  • value  416430
    address  3HhpHyci7dMfkwbyRD2jWQXFL3LHF7H5Xx
  • 515886c7f6125fcfa81d6df5451ad7fe6e8f025de9c3639cc2d4b9d0437ec52d:1
  • value  300663
    address  bc1qxy2f7lpnffg9drfjpcwtzylmq4t9zs50an3nhp